设为首页收藏本站

最大的系统仿真与系统优化公益交流社区

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 7392|回复: 1

[悬赏] 请教TABLEFILE抓取不同栏位之列数问题

[复制链接]
发表于 2009-7-30 11:12:17 | 显示全部楼层 |阅读模式
10仿真币
请问一下,
) g: A2 j6 K& ]/ {7 @/ X5 ~9 n* s7 L5 ]$ b8 r% w# V9 o
假设现在有两个栏位,6 D3 i! Y3 `) @
* m  k' {0 b! j5 [7 w% f" f# A
第一个栏位有7列,第二个栏位有5列,: m2 h9 H( u/ U

+ ^9 x  q* o4 H+ p; s因为使用tablefile.ydim只会出现该tablefile中最大列数,4 l' o" Y) G5 L1 M( y6 e7 I4 p" ~* B

6 M. J$ i+ T: V以我举的例子为例会显示7,
5 C( v/ v# C6 B* Y6 {$ }
  \) N) Z* n; Z: @- l1 n! d但现在我想要抓第二个栏位的列数(5列),9 E* c3 D0 C( [0 u
1 j2 ^2 [. A: B/ x
请问有这个指令吗?0 {3 h7 I# n( F: F9 k
: p$ y& l" p0 t# H" T
谢谢!

发表于 2009-7-30 17:44:19 | 显示全部楼层
for a := tablefile.ydim downto 1 loop
& T1 S6 m( l' i' w3 [                if tablefile[2,a] = 0 then3 A, u5 n& C) B/ r& }9 I# n* A
                        --a-1就是你想要的那个值了。5 Z, J  U1 F  ^: o/ U' R
                end;
( s& d6 L" \* i  o8 y" i        next;
您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|Archiver|手机版|SimulWay 道于仿真   

GMT+8, 2025-10-27 12:39 , Processed in 0.012022 second(s), 11 queries .

Powered by Discuz! X3.4 Licensed

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表